As we age, our skin goes through various changes, and one of the most noticeable is the appearance of age spots, also known as liver spots. These dark, flat areas on the skin can appear almost anywhere, but theyโre most common on the face, hands, and armsโareas frequently exposed to the sun. ๐๐ค So, what exactly causes these pesky spots, and how can we deal with them? Letโs find out!
The Sun: Your Skinโs Worst Enemy โ๏ธ๐ซ
The primary culprit behind age spots is none other than the sun. Over time, repeated exposure to UV rays can cause an overproduction of melanin, the pigment that gives your skin its color. This excess melanin clumps together, forming those dark spots. ๐๐ If youโve spent a lot of time in the sun without proper protection, youโre more likely to develop age spots. Hormonal Changes: The Invisible Culprits ๐งฌ๐ฉธ
While the sun is a major factor, hormonal changes can also contribute to the development of age spots. As we age, our hormone levels fluctuate, which can affect how our skin produces melanin. For example, during menopause, women may experience increased melanin production, leading to darker spots. ๐๐ฉโ๐ฆณ Hormonal changes can be tricky to manage, but understanding them can help you take better care of your skin.

Prevention and Treatment: Taking Control of Your Skin Health ๐ก๏ธ๐
The good news is that there are ways to prevent and treat age spots. Here are a few tips:
- Sun Protection: Always wear sunscreen with at least SPF 30, even on cloudy days. A wide-brimmed hat and sunglasses can also help shield your skin from harmful UV rays. ๐๐งข
- Skincare Routine: Use products with retinoids, alpha hydroxy acids (AHAs), or vitamin C to help fade existing spots and prevent new ones from forming. ๐งด๐งด
- Professional Treatments: Consider laser therapy, chemical peels, or microdermabrasion for more stubborn spots. Consult a dermatologist to find the best treatment for your skin type. ๐ฅ๐ฉโโ๏ธ
